About Bay Area Selections

Bay Area Selections refers to a lineage of cannabis cultivars developed and stabilized by breeders operating in the San Francisco Bay Area region, primarily during the 1990s and 2000s. These strains often emphasize phenotypic stability and adaptation to local microclimates, with documented ancestry tracing back to both landrace and established hybrid stock. Notable cultivars within this family are frequently cited in breeding records as parent material for later-generation crosses, particularly those targeting specific terpene profiles or growth characteristics. Bay Area breeding work became influential in California's broader cannabis genetics community, with many contemporary strains carrying genetic material from this regional selection pool. Breeder relevance

Breeders working with Bay Area Selections genetics often use them as foundation stock for stabilizing desirable traits in outcrosses, or to introduce regional adaptation markers into new hybrid lines. These selections serve as reference genetics when documenting California cannabis breeding history and terroir-influenced phenotype development.
